Mar 04, 2020In 'The mining industry in Zimbabwe: labour, capital and the state', published in Africa Development by John Bradbury and Eric Worby, the writers note that by 1980, up to 95% of the country's mineral output was produced and controlled by foreign companies, a model that led to a dramatic concentration of the mining workforce in a few projects.

May 10, 2021Top five largest iron ore producing companies in the world in 2020. 1. Vale – 300 million tonnes. Brazilian miner Vale was the world's top producer of iron ore in 2020, with an output totalling just over 300 million tonnes – a small decline from 2019 when it produced 302 million tonnes of the metallic ore. Apr 03, 2015Over 300 minerals contain iron but five minerals are the primary sources of iron ore. They are (i) magnetite (Fe3O4), (ii) hematite (Fe2O3), (iii) goethite (Fe2O3.H2O), (iv) siderite (FeCO3), and (v) pyrite (FeS2). The first three are of major importance because of their occurrence in large economically minable deposits.

Zimbabwe Iron and Steel Company is the largest steel works in Zimbabwe. In 1956, iron ore output from the company was 127,954 tons. By 1957, this had doubled to 257,166 tons. It gets raw materials (such as iron ore) from Ripple Creek mine which is about 14 kilometers from ZISCO. Up to 70 million tonnes can be mined.
